Streptococcus is a bacteria that is characteristic grouping of chains resembles a string of beads. Streptococcus lactis is used in commercial starters for the production of butter, cultured buttermilk and certain cheeses.
The oxidase test result for Lactococcus lactis ssp lactis is negative. This bacterium lacks the enzyme cytochrome c oxidase that is needed to produce a positive result in the oxidase test.

Lactococcus lactis is a spherical-shaped bacterium that typically occurs in pairs or chains. It is a Gram-positive bacterium that does not form spores and is non-motile. The arrangement of L. lactis can vary depending on growth conditions and phase of growth.
Lactococcus lactis is a bacteria commonly used in the production of dairy products like cheese and yogurt, while Enterococcus faecalis is a bacteria that is often found in the intestines of animals and humans. L. lactis is generally considered safe, whereas E. faecalis can be a pathogen and cause infections in humans, particularly in hospital settings. Additionally, L. lactis is a lactic acid bacterium used in fermentation processes, while E. faecalis is a member of the Enterococcus genus known for its ability to survive in harsh environments.
